The iPhone 12 Pro, released in October 2020, and the iPhone 14 Pro Max, launched in September 2022, represent different generations within Apple's premium smartphone lineup. Both devices operate on Apple's iOS ecosystem, offering a consistent user experience. The primary distinctions lie in the iPhone 14 Pro Max's larger and more advanced display, a significantly upgraded camera system, and a more powerful internal processor.

User sentiment for the iPhone 12 Pro often highlights its continued solid performance for everyday tasks and its capable camera system, even several years after its release. Many appreciate its more manageable size compared to the larger Pro Max models. However, common criticisms include its 60Hz display, which feels less fluid than newer high-refresh-rate screens, and its battery life, which some users find requires more frequent charging, especially with heavy use or as the battery ages.
The iPhone 14 Pro Max generally receives high praise for its exceptional battery life, often lasting a full day for even demanding users. Its vibrant 120Hz ProMotion display with the Dynamic Island is frequently cited as a significant upgrade, offering a more immersive and interactive experience. The camera system is also a major highlight, with users noting substantial improvements in low-light performance and overall detail. Some users, however, mention its considerable size and weight as a potential drawback.
Users prioritizing a more compact device with still-capable performance and camera features for general use may find the iPhone 12 Pro suitable. Those who value the latest camera technology, extended battery life, a larger and smoother display, and advanced safety features will likely find the iPhone 14 Pro Max better aligned with their needs.
